#!/bin/ksh
#
# This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
# it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by
# the Free Software Foundation; either version 2 of the License, or
# (at your option) any later version.
#
# This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
# but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
# M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the
# GNU General Public License for more details.
#
# You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License
# along with this program; if not, write to the Free Software
# Foundation, Inc., 59 Temple Place, Suite 330, Boston, MA 02111-1307 USA
#
# (c)Copyright 2006 Hewlett-Packard Development Company, LP.
#
#
#
# Build script
# Unix
# Creation: 2004/01/28
# Version 1.0
#
COMMAND_EXECUTED=$0
# Default values
BUILD_DEFAULT_TARGET=all
BUILD_DEFAULT_EXEC=RELEASE
# Init of variables
BUILD_TARGET=${BUILD_DEFAULT_TARGET}
BUILD_EXEC=${BUILD_DEFAULT_EXEC}
typeset -u BUILD_OS=`uname -s | tr '-' '_' | tr '.' '_' | tr '/' '_' `
BUILD_CODE_DIRECTORY=code
BUILD_DIRECTORY=`pwd`
typeset -u BUILD_ARCH=`uname -m | tr '-' '_' | tr '.' '_' | tr '/' '_' `
BUILD_VERSION_FILE=build.conf
BUILD_DIST_MODE=0
BUILD_FORCE_MODE=0
function usage
{
echo "Command line syntax of $1 - options"
echo "-exec <RELEASE|DEBUG> : mode used for compilation (default ${BUILD_DEFAULT_EXEC})"
echo "-target <all|clean|force|dist> : target used for compilation (default ${BUILD_DEFAULT_TARGET})"
echo "-help : display the command line syntax"
}
function error
{
echo "ERROR: $1"
exit 1
}
function warning
{
echo "WARNING: $1"
}
function get_arguments
{
while [ $# -ne 0 ]
do
case $1 in
-exec)
shift
if [ $# -ne 0 ]
then
case $1 in
RELEASE|DEBUG)
;;
*)
error "Unrecognized -exec option argument"
;;
esac
BUILD_EXEC=$1
else
error "executable mode needed (RELEASE or DEBUG)"
fi
;;
-target)
shift
if [ $# -ne 0 ]
then
case $1 in
dist)
BUILD_DIST_MODE=1
;;
all|clean)
;;
force)
BUILD_FORCE_MODE=1
;;
*)
error "Unrecognized -target option argument"
;;
esac
BUILD_TARGET=$1
else
error "target needed (all, clean or sample)"
fi
;;
-help)
usage ${COMMAND_EXECUTED}
exit 0
;;
*)
error "unrecognized option $1"
;;
esac
shift
done
}
function check_dlfcn {
if test -f /usr/lib/libdld.sl
then
nm /usr/lib/libdld.sl | grep dlopen >/dev/null
if test $? -eq 0
then
echo "-DUSE_DLOPEN"
else
echo ""
fi
fi
}
# Arguments analysis
get_arguments $*
if test -f ${BUILD_VERSION_FILE}
then
. ./${BUILD_VERSION_FILE}
#BUILD_VERSION & BUILD_NAME
BUILD_VERSION=${PROJECT_VERSION}
BUILD_NAME=${PROJECT_NAME}
else
error "no version file ${BUILD_VERSION_FILE} found"
fi
# Print build environment
echo "[System : ${BUILD_OS}]"
echo "[Archi : ${BUILD_ARCH}]"
echo "[Mode : ${BUILD_EXEC}]"
echo "[Name : ${BUILD_NAME}]"
echo "[Version : ${BUILD_VERSION}]"
BUILD_WORK="${BUILD_DIRECTORY}/work-${BUILD_VERSION}"
BUILD_BUILD="${BUILD_DIRECTORY}/build-${BUILD_VERSION}"
EXT_DIR="${BUILD_DIRECTORY}/ext-${BUILD_VERSION}"
# In case of Distribution build just build all
if test ${BUILD_DIST_MODE} -eq 1
then
BUILD_TARGET=all
fi
case ${BUILD_EXEC} in
RELEASE)
# Nothing more to do
DEBUG_MODE=""
;;
DEBUG)
# Change build option for debug mode
DEBUG_MODE="DBG"
;;
esac
# In case of Force mode do a clean first
if test ${BUILD_FORCE_MODE} -eq 1
then
echo " "
echo "[Begin Clean Forced phase]"
(make -f Makefile-generic.mk clean "WORK_DIR="${BUILD_WORK} "BUILD_DIR="${BUILD_BUILD} "BUILD_NAME="${BUILD_NAME} "EXT_BUILD_DIR="${EXT_DIR} "CURRENT_DIR="${BUILD_DIRECTORY} "DEBUG_MODE="${DEBUG_MODE} && echo "[End Makefile generation phase OK]")
# set the target to all now
BUILD_TARGET=all
fi
# Build the required target
echo " "
echo "[Begin Makefile generation phase]"
(make -f Makefile-generic.mk ${BUILD_TARGET} "WORK_DIR="${BUILD_WORK} "BUILD_DIR="${BUILD_BUILD} "BUILD_NAME="${BUILD_NAME} "EXT_BUILD_DIR="${EXT_DIR} "CURRENT_DIR="${BUILD_DIRECTORY} "DEBUG_MODE="${DEBUG_MODE} && echo "[End Makefile generation phase OK]")
# Now determine the real target
# in case of distributation change the target
if test ${BUILD_DIST_MODE} -eq 1
then
BUILD_TARGET=dist
fi
if test -f ${BUILD_WORK}/project.mk
then
echo " "
echo "[Begin compilation phase]"
(make -f ${BUILD_WORK}/project.mk ${BUILD_TARGET} "WORK_DIR="${BUILD_WORK} "BUILD_DIR="${BUILD_BUILD} "BUILD_NAME="${BUILD_NAME} && echo "[End compilation phase OK]" )
fi
echo " "
